Background

Surgical site infection (SSI) is a major postoperative complication following internal fixation or arthroplasty for proximal femoral fracture (PFF). Few studies have examined the potential risk factors for SSI; therefore, we conducted this matched-pair analysis.

Materials and methods

This single-centre study was based on a retrospective database of patients treated for PFF with internal fixation or arthroplasty between 2006 and 2024. Patients with revision for SSI were enrolled and matched with an uneventfully treated group at a 1:3 ratio. Matching was performed on the basis of sex, age, body mass index, diagnosis and treatment. The primary outcomes were risk factors for SSI. The secondary outcomes were risk factors for mortality, as determined by multivariate Cox regression analysis.

Results

Initially, a total of 5000 patients were enrolled. The mean follow-up was 11.7 years. The total SSI rate was 2.8% (140/5,000). Ultimately, 130 patients with confirmed SSI and 390 matched patients were enrolled in this study. Most of the SSIs were Staphylococcus aureus, followed by Staphylococcus epidermidis. The factors that significantly influenced SSI were female sex, American Society of Anaesthesiologists (ASA) score of 4, dementia, atrial fibrillation, and the number of red blood transfusions (≥ 3 units). The mean survival duration of the total cohort was 4.2 years (SD ± 3.38). The 30-day, 3-month and 1-year all-cause mortality rates of patients with SSIs were 5.4%, 25.4%, and 40%, respectively. Multivariate Cox regression revealed that SSI was an independent risk factor for mortality (hazard ratio 1.59; 95% confidence interval 1.28–1.98; p < 0.001), Further risk factors for mortality were living in a retirement home, reduced mobility, anaemia at admission, elevated C-reactive protein, ASA score 3 or 4, intraoperative blood loss greater than 400 ml, Charlson comorbidity index score above ≥ 1, dementia and renal insufficiency.

Conclusions

In this study, patients with SSI following surgery of PFF had a significantly shorter survival time than patients in the uneventfully treated matched-pair group. Most risk factors associated with SSI are unaffected. Fortunately, the rate of SSI was low and decreased significantly within the study period.

Lever of evidence

III; clinical case series with matched pair controls.
